Abstract

The properties of a Pt-10% Rh gauze catalyst, modified by coating its surface with alumina film containing dispersed platinum metals, have been studied. The conversion, process yield and morphological changes of the surface of the modified catalyst are compared with those of a standard gauze applied in the HCN synthesis. For the first time it has been demonstrated, basing on HRTEM observations, that formation of a Pt-Al intermetallic compound on the surface of the gauze catalyst occurs under the conditions of HCN synthesis by Andrussov's method.
